Osula and Burn put Newcastle 2-0 up, Hinshelwood replied, then Barnes struck at 90+5 for 3-1. Pope mixed errors with key saves. Win ends five straight defeats and eases pressure on Eddie Howe.

Brighton boss Fabian Hürzeler insisted ‘we dominated’ despite Newcastle’s 3-1 win. Osula and Burn scored, Hinshelwood replied, Barnes sealed it late. Stats showed 33% possession for Newcastle, shots 13-13.
